This Day in African History: 26 January

A chronicle of events in African history on this day

1952, 26 January
Egypt is placed under martial law in response to wide-spread riots against the British.

1986, 26 January
The National Resistance Army takes over the Ugandan capital of Kampala.

1991, 26 January
Rebels overrun the Somalian capital of Mogadishu.
